Decarbonising Planes Without Batteries or Hydrogen? For Now, Here’s How

In this episode of the Climate Confident podcast, I speak with Alexei Beltyukov, co-founder of Universal Fuel Technologies, about a new approach to producing Sustainable Aviation Fuel (SAF), using a process they call flexiforming.
Unlike traditional methods like HEFA or Fischer–Tropsch, flexiforming allows producers to use a much wider range of feedstocks, from mixed alcohols to naphtas and renewable waste streams, and turn them into jet fuel, renewable diesel, or chemicals. This flexibility is critical as SAF demand surges, especially with EU mandates requiring a rising share of SAF in jet fuel starting in 2025.
We explore:
- Why SAF is the only viable decarbonisation path for long-haul aviation (for now)
- What sets flexiforming apart from conventional SAF production
- How current SAF mandates and incentives (EU vs. US) shape supply and pricing
- Why scaling SAF requires compatibility with existing refinery infrastructure
- The role consumer awareness might play in driving airline demand
Alexei also makes the case for slow but steady growth in SAF adoption, pointing to its current double-digit annual growth and comparing its trajectory to that of electric vehicles 10 years ago.
